Types of Car Keys
Car keys have developed significantly over the years, moving from basic metal keys to complex electronic devices. Here's a breakdown of the most typical kinds of keys used in lorries today:
Type of KeyDescriptionStandard KeysStandard metal keys that by hand run the ignition and locks of older designs.Transponder KeysEquipped with a microchip that communicates with the car's engine, improving security.Key FobsRemote devices that lock/unlock doors and typically start the car without inserting a key.Smart KeysAdvanced systems that enable for keyless entry and ignition, typically with proximity sensors.Valet KeysUnique keys that limit access to certain functions, usually utilized by parking attendants.The Replacement Process
When faced with the requirement to replace an automobile key, the procedure can vary based upon the type of key and the scenarios. Below are the typical actions associated with key replacement:

Identifying the Type of Key: Determine the kind of key you require. Check if it's a basic key, transponder key, or wise key.

Gathering Necessary Information: Collect essential information about your vehicle, including:
Vehicle Identification Number (VIN)Car make and designYear of manufacture
Choosing a Replacement Method:
Dealer Replacement: The car dealer can offer a replacement key, frequently for newer models geared up with advanced innovation.Locksmith Services: Professional automotive locksmiths can duplicate or replace conventional keys and transponder keys, normally at a lower expense than dealers.DIY Options: Some car owners choose diy kits offered online, but this is usually only a good idea for traditional keys.
Cutting and Programming: If a transponder or wise key is involved, programming will be needed to make sure that the key can communicate with the vehicle's security system.

Testing the New Key: Once the key is replaced, it's vital to check it to make sure that it begins the car and runs all pertinent locks.
Key Replacement Costs
The cost of automobile key replacement can differ significantly depending upon the kind of key and the approach of replacement. Here's a general overview of the potential costs:
Type of KeyEstimated Cost RangeTraditional Keys₤ 5 - ₤ 20Transponder Keys₤ 50 - ₤ 150Key Fobs₤ 70 - ₤ 250Smart Keys₤ 200 - ₤ 500Dealer ReplacementUsually 20% - 50% more than locksmith professional servicesFactors Influencing Cost:Complexity: More advanced keys cost more to make and program.Dealership vs. Locksmith: Dealerships frequently charge greater prices for the same service provided by a locksmith.Area: Prices may differ in different regions, affected by regional competition and demand.Frequently Asked Questions About Automobile Key Replacement1. The length of time does it require to replace a car key?
The time required to replace a car key depends on the key type and method picked. Standard keys can be made within minutes, while transponder and wise key replacements might take longer due to programming.
2. Can I replace my key myself?
While some types of keys, particularly conventional ones, can be replaced by the vehicle owner, transponder and wise keys often require special devices and know-how to program.
3. What should I do if I lose both sets of keys?
If both sets of keys are lost, the finest course of action is to contact a dealership or a professional locksmith with the vehicle's VIN. They can produce a new key from scratch.
4. Do I require to offer evidence of ownership for key replacement?
Yes, to avoid theft, a lot of dealerships and locksmiths need evidence of ownership, such as a title, registration, or insurance coverage document.
5. Can I configure a key myself?
Some automobiles allow for self-programming of spare keys, however most contemporary transponder and clever keys will require expert devices and support.
